【JavaScript源代码】node.js安装及HbuilderX配置详解.docx
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
node.js安装及HbuilderX配置详解 npm安装教程: 官网:https://nodejs.org/en/ webpack: 它主要的用途是通过CommonJS的语法把所有浏览器端需要发布的静态资源做相应的准备,比如资源的合并和打包。 vue-cli: 用户生成Vue工程模板。(帮你快速开始一个vue的项目,也就是给你一套vue的结构,包含基础的依赖库,只需要 npm install就可以安装) 如图,现在下载的版本是14.16.0 LTS (推荐用户现在使用): 双击安装 1.首先我们可以看到的是默认的为C盘路径,这里就我们以D盘为例子进行安装:d:\node.j 【JavaScript源代码】这篇文档主要讲述了如何安装Node.js和配置HbuilderX,同时涉及了npm、webpack和vue-cli等关键工具的使用。 1. **Node.js安装**:访问Node.js官网(https://nodejs.org/en/)下载最新版本,如14.16.0 LTS。默认安装路径通常在C盘,但可以更改到D盘或其他自选位置。安装过程中需按照提示点击Next和Finish。安装完成后,验证Node.js是否成功安装,通过命令行输入`node -v`和`npm -v`查看版本。 2. **npm配置**:npm是Node.js的包管理器,用于安装和管理依赖。默认情况下,npm的本地仓库位于C盘用户目录下。可以通过命令`npm config set prefix "D:\nodejs\node_global"`和`npm config set cache "D:\nodejs\node_cache"`将npm全局目录和缓存移动到D盘。设置镜像站为中国大陆的淘宝npm源,命令为`npm config set registry=http://registry.npm.taobao.org`,验证设置正确性,使用`npm config get registry`或`npm info vue`。 3. **环境变量设置**:为了使新的全局模块路径生效,需要添加环境变量NODE_PATH,值为`D:\nodejs\node_global\node_modules`。安装全局模块时,使用`npm install <module> -g`命令。 4. **vue-cli安装与使用**:vue-cli是用于创建Vue项目的脚手架工具,通过`npm install vue-cli -g`全局安装。初始化项目时,可以选择是否安装vue-router,其他默认选择No。之后,运行`npm install`安装项目依赖,`npm run dev`启动开发服务器,访问`http://localhost:8080`查看项目。完成开发后,运行`npm run build`生成生产环境的静态文件。 5. **HbuilderX配置**:HbuilderX是一款流行的Web开发工具,通过其内置的终端可以方便地运行npm命令,如`npm run dev`。安装HbuilderX(https://www.dcloud.io/hbuilderx.html),配置Node.js和npm路径,使得项目能够顺利运行。 以上就是Node.js的安装与npm配置,以及使用vue-cli创建Vue项目的基本流程。在实际开发中,还需要了解和掌握webpack的配置和使用,因为它是现代前端项目中常见的构建工具,能够处理资源合并、打包等工作。Vue-router则是Vue.js中的路由管理库,用于管理应用的页面跳转和状态。HbuilderX则提供了一整套便捷的开发环境,帮助开发者更高效地编写和管理代码。
- 粉丝: 4129
- 资源: 1万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- (源码)基于Qt和AVR的FestosMechatronics系统终端.zip
- (源码)基于Java的DVD管理系统.zip
- (源码)基于Java RMI的共享白板系统.zip
- (源码)基于Spring Boot和WebSocket的毕业设计选题系统.zip
- (源码)基于C++的机器人与船舶管理系统.zip
- (源码)基于WPF和Entity Framework Core的智能货架管理系统.zip
- SAP Note 532932 FAQ Valuation logic with active material ledger
- (源码)基于Spring Boot和Redis的秒杀系统.zip
- (源码)基于C#的计算器系统.zip
- (源码)基于ESP32和ThingSpeak的牛舍环境监测系统.zip
- 1
- 2
- 3
前往页